## Formula sandbox tuning

User-supplied formulas in Gridmoor execute inside a restricted interpreter with hard ceilings on time, memory, and call depth. Reviewers should confirm any change to these ceilings is justified in the PR description, since raising them widens the abuse surface. Defaults were chosen from production traces. The current limits are as follows.

limits module of tafog-fawip:
WEIGHTS = {
    "julix": 57,
    "lamys": 992,
    "kasvan": 209,
    "quenok": 750,
    "alddor": 259,
    "oliath": 1009,
    "wenix": 815,
}

As part of the Brindlecore migration, all build targets are moving from the legacy shell scripts to Hermetica, our sealed build system. Hermetica disallows network access during compilation, so every dependency must be declared in the manifest and mirrored to the internal artifact store, Cratchvault. When you port a target, verify the output hash matches across two clean machines before merging — nondeterminism bugs are much cheaper to catch now. To publish mirrored artifacts to Cratchvault during the migration, authenticate with the key below.

gateway credential: kto23_LX9A4ys6i4nzHtpOLNLodKK

Subject: Stringsift cut-over recap

Welcome aboard. Over the weekend we moved all repositories from the old extraction wrapper to Stringsift, which now pulls translatable strings on every merge to main. Please verify your local runs match CI exactly, since mismatched options produce spurious diffs in the catalog files. For reference, the script runs in production with the following configuration values.

config for kajog-tadug:
[casax]
port = 11211
region = west-3
host = casax.nelvroworks.internal
timeout_ms = 5000
retries = 7

# Break-Glass: Roundfix Conversion Service

If Roundfix drifts more than 0.5 basis points on currency rounding, ledger reconciliation at Quillbank halts. Normal access goes through the Tarn approval queue; break-glass skips it. Only use during an active sev-1. Log the incident in the Ashgrove tracker afterward. To unlock the break-glass credential store, enter the recovery passphrase below.

unlock words, kajeg-fahif: holmir-casael-novdor